Diablo II: Lord of Destruction, released in 2000, remains a cornerstone of the action RPG genre, captivating gamers with its dark gothic atmosphere, engaging gameplay, and extensive character customization. The 1.13c version, in particular, is notable for its stability and balance, making it a preferred choice among enthusiasts. This repack aims to provide an easy and efficient way to experience the game with all its patches and necessary files included.

The repack benefits from the active Diablo II community, which continues to create mods, maps, and other custom content. The 1.13c version, being a stable and popular iteration, has extensive support for various mods, ranging from simple tweaks to complete overhauls.

The repack version of Diablo II: Lord of Destruction 1.13c retains the core elements that made the game a classic. Players can choose from five unique character classes, each with its own strengths and playstyles, offering hours of gameplay and replayability. The addition of two new character classes, the Assassin and the Druid, through the Lord of Destruction expansion significantly enriches the game.

The Diablo II: Lord of Destruction 1.13c Repack offers an excellent way for both new and veteran players to dive into one of the most iconic action RPGs of all time. With its preserved gameplay, simplified installation, and access to a rich modding community, it's a great experience for anyone looking to explore a classic game.

The game's dark, gothic world is still visually captivating, with detailed character models and environments. The soundtrack and sound effects contribute significantly to the game's atmosphere, making the experience immersive. While the graphics may seem dated compared to modern games, they hold up well for a title over two decades old.
